html, body {
	height: 100%;
	width: 100%;
	background: url(../img/background.jpg) repeat top left;
	background-size: fixed;
	color: #111;
}
@font-face
{
font-family: 'Khmer UI';
src: url(KHMERUIB.TTF);
}
p {
	font-family: 'Khmer UI';
	font-size: 0.9em;
	font-weight: bold;
}
.no-space {
	margin: 0px;
}
.left {
	float: left !important;
}
.right {
	float: right !important;
}
.center {
	margin: 0 auto;
}
.underline {
	text-decoration: underline;
}
.container {
	width: 1000px;
	background: url(../img/bg-all.png) center bottom repeat-x;
	background:  url(../img/bg-all2.png) left top repeat-y, url(../img/bg-all.png) center bottom repeat-x;
}
.span13 {
	width: 1000px;
}
header {
	margin: 0 auto;
	width: 1000px;
	background: url(../img/banner22.gif) no-repeat top left;
	height: 270px;
}
footer {
	border-top: 1px solid #eee;
	clear: both;
	background-color: #000;
	height: 30px;
}
#flash-banner {
	position: relative;
	top: 20px;
	left: 290px;
}
nav {
	border-bottom: 1px solid #000;
}
.meniu {
	width: 700px;
	margin-left: auto !important;
	margin-right: auto;
}
.meniu > li > a {
	position: relative;
	top: 10px;
	text-transform: uppercase;
	font-size: 1em;
	color: #000;
	font-weight: bold;
	padding-right: 10px;
	padding-left: 10px;
}
.meniu > li > a:hover {
	text-decoration: none;
}
.meniu > li {
	height: 40px;
	background: url(../img/menu-bg.png) no-repeat left bottom;
}
.meniu > li:hover {
	-webkit-transition: all 0.4s ease-in-out;
  	-moz-transition: all 0.4s ease-in-out;
  	-o-transition: all 0.4s ease-in-out;
  	transition: all 0.4s ease-in-out;
	background: url(../img/menu-bg.png) no-repeat center top;
}
.meniu > li:after {
	left: 7px;
	top: 10px;
	position: relative;
	display: inline-block;
	content: "";
	height: 13px;
	width: 1px;
	background-color: #000;
}
.meniu > li:last-child:after {
	display: inline-block;
	content: "";
	height: 0px;
	width: 0px;
	background-color: #000;
}

.main {
	margin-bottom: 20px;
	overflow: hidden;
	margin-left: 70px;

}
h1 {
	font-family: 'Hammersmith One';
	color: #000;
	font-size: 1.2em;
}
h2 {
	font-family: 'Hammersmith One';
	font-size: 1.2em;
}
#pg1 {
	font-weight: 100;
	height: 40px;
}
#pg1:after {
	font-family: 'Khmer UI';
	font-size: 0.8em;
	left: 11%;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 Dinamism, Creativitate, Promtitudine definesc STANTFORM in tot ceea ce facem.";
	width: 90%;
	border-bottom: 1px solid #000;
}
#pg1en {
	font-weight: 100;
	height: 40px;
}
#pg1en:after {
	font-family: 'Khmer UI';
	font-size: 0.8em;
	left: 11%;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 Dynamism, Creativity, Daring and great Care define STANTFORM in everything we do.";
	width: 90%;
	border-bottom: 1px solid #000;
}
#pg2 {
	margin-bottom: 20px;
	font-weight: 100;
	height: 50px;
}
#pg2:after {
	font-weight: bold;
	font-family: 'Khmer UI';
	line-height: 2.1;
	font-size: 0.9em;
	left: 190px;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 Realizam la comanda orice tip de forma de stanta plana: \A  \00a0 \00a0 \00a0 \00a0 \00a0 de biguit, decupat si perforat prin taiere cu LASER.";
	width: 90%;
	border-bottom: 1px solid #000;
	white-space:pre;
}
#pg2en {
	font-weight: 100;
	height: 50px;
}
#pg2en:after {
	font-family: 'Khmer UI';
	line-height: 2.1;
	font-size: 0.8em;
	left: 110px;
	height: 27px;
	top: -40px;
	font-weight: bold;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0  \00a0  \00a0  \00a0 \00a0 \00a0 \00a0 \00a0  We manufacter on ther order we receive any flat or die board: \A  \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0  \00a0  \00a0  \00a0 \00a0 \00a0 \00a0 \00a0 creasing die, cutting and perforating dies, by SCROLL or LASER cutting.";
	width: 90%;
	border-bottom: 1px solid #000;
	white-space:pre;
}
#pg21 {
	font-weight: 100;
	height: 50px;
}
#pg21:after {
	font-family: 'Khmer UI';
	line-height: 2.1;
	font-size: 0.7em;
	left: 149px;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 ";
	width: 90%;
	border-bottom: 1px solid #000;
	white-space:pre;
}
#pg3 {
	font-weight: 100;
	height: 50px;
}
#pg3:after {
	font-family: 'Khmer UI';
	line-height: 2.1;
	font-size: 0.9em;
	left: 160px;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 Pretul este cuprins intre 8 - 25 euro/metru liniar cutit sau big utilizat.";
	width: 90%;
	border-bottom: 1px solid #000;
	white-space:pre;
}
#pg3en {
	font-weight: 100;
	height: 50px;
}
#pg3en:after {
	font-family: 'Khmer UI';
	line-height: 2.1;
	font-size: 0.7em;
	left: 90px;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 The price ranges between 8-25 euro/per meter, knife or creasing rules.";
	width: 90%;
	border-bottom: 1px solid #000;
}
#pgc {
	display: inline;
	font-weight: 100;
	height: 50px;
}
#pgc:after {

	line-height: 2.1;
	font-size: 0.7em;
	height: 27px;
	top: 0px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 ";
	width: 33%;
	border-bottom: 1px solid #000;
	white-space: pre;
}
#pgc1 {
	font-weight: 100;
	height: 50px;
}
#pgc1:after {
	line-height: 2.1;
	font-size: 0.7em;
	left: 149px;
	height: 27px;
	top: -40px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 ";
	width: 90%;
	border-bottom: 1px solid #000;
	white-space:pre;
}
#pgc2 {
	display: inline;
	font-weight: 100;
	height: 50px;
}
#pgc2:after {
	line-height: 2.1;
	font-size: 0.7em;
	right: 0;
	height: 27px;
	top: 0px;
	position: relative;
	display: inline-block;
	content: "\00a0 \00a0 \00a0 \00a0 \00a0 \00a0 \00a0 ";
	width: 244px;
	border-bottom: 1px solid #000;
	white-space: pre;
}
.pad-left {
	padding-left: 100px;
}
.pad-left2 {
	padding-left: 60px;
}
.pad-left3 {
	height: 513px;
	width: 408px;
padding-bottom: 0px;
color: #000;
padding-top: 71px;
padding-left: 328px;
font-size: 13px;
}
#pg1-img-right {
	float:  right;
	padding-right: 50px;
	padding-top: 40px;
}
.fot-p {
	font-size: 1em;
	-webkit-font-smoothing: antialiased;
	-webkit-text-shadow: rgba(0,0,0,.01) 0 0 1px;
	font-weight: 200;
	position: relative;
	top: 5px;
	color: #fff;
	margin: 5px 30px;
}
div.img img {
	padding-right: 0;
}
img {
	padding-right:10px;
	height: 100%;
}
.cont {
	padding-top: 30px;
	width: 700px;
	display: inline-block;
}

#txt_area_3 {
	background: url(../img/pg1-text.png) no-repeat top left;	
	font-family: 'Khmer UI';
	font-size: 13px;
	font-weight: bold;
	text-align: left;
	vertical-align: top;
	margin: 20px 193px;
	height: 50px;
	width: 530px;
	padding-left: 30px;
	padding-top: 5px;
	padding-right: 30px;
}
.lista-servicii {
	color: #000;
	padding: 5px;
	padding-left: 0px;
	/*background: url(../img/txt_area_3_empty.png) no-repeat top left;*/
	list-style: none;
	font-weight: bold;
}
.lista-servicii-en {
	height: 200px;
	color: #000;
	padding: 20px;

	list-style: none;
	font-weight: bold;
}
.galerie-a {
	color: #000;
	font-size: 1.1em;
	font-weight: bold;
}
.galerie-a:hover {
	text-decoration: none;
}
#pret {
	margin-left: 50px;
	clear: both;
	font-family: Arial;
	line-height: 10px;
	font-size: 0.9em;
	font-weight: bold;
	float: left;
	margin-bottom: 10px;
}
#pret th {
	border-bottom: 1px solid #000;
}

#pret tr > td {
	border-right: 1px solid #000;
}
#pret tr > td +td {
	border: none;
}
#pret tr:hover {
	border: 1px solid #000;
}
#pret tr:last-child {
	border-bottom: 1px solid #000;
}
#pret tr:first-child {
	border: none;
}
img {
	height: auto;
	width: auto;
}
.main-despre {
	margin-left: 0px;
	background: url(../img/harta.png) no-repeat top left;
	width: 1000px;
}
.f-c {
	font-family: 'Khmer UI';
	padding-top: 30px;
	width: 350px;
}
.list-contact {
	margin:0;
	margin-top: 20px;
	list-style: none;
	display: inline-block;
}
.list-contact li {
	line-height: 30px;
}
nav > div {
	width: 770px;
	margin: 0 auto;
}
nav > div > span {
	display: inline-block;
}
nav > div > span img {
	padding-right: 3px;
	padding-top: 10px; 
}
nav > div > ul {
	display: inline-block;
}
#en-h {
	background: url(../img/banner23.gif);
}